In 1889, a treaty was signed between the native americans and the united states government opening the land north of the niobrara river for settlement. The mission of the naper historical society is to preserve, interpret, display, communicate, promote and honor history, original structures, special places and artifacts of the people and culture of naper, nebraska, and the surrounding area.
